Anyway, to get back on track to Windows 10 - I currently have it installed on 3 PC's in my game room: my main gaming rig, my Alienware laptop, and my arcade stand build. Looking at the OS as a just a gamer, I've been very happy with it.
There have been gamer speed-bumps, sure. As mentioned, the broken Xbox One controller driver was silly. But there was an easy fix. I can understand gamers being upset at the SecureROM lock-out, but there is actually logic to that decision AND there are workarounds if you want to jump through some hoops.
But all in all, I think it's a great OS for gaming. Killer Instinct is hitting PC this week. I'm pretty sure that's the first PC game I'm knowingly picking up that is Win10 only.
